Abstract:
      In the light of the sea level synoptic charts from July to August for 1975-1978, we obtained more observed records of low latitudes by using the analysed stream and temperature-moisture field (or so called energy field θe field and θse field), the main characteristics of these fields in the period of multi-typhoon genesis and of typhoon interval in the mid-summer are studied.
Finally, it should be pointed out that the position of the typhoon genesis and the typhoon track are generally consistent with the low temperature-moisture region of the sea surface as well as with its tendency, so that a valuable information is obtained for the forecast of the typhoon track.
